Ingredients
| Ingredient description | Matched product | 
|---|---|
| Crust | |
| 3 3/4 (470 grams) cups all-purpose flour | Wheat flour · white · all-purpose · unenriched - 3.75 cup | 
| 1 1/2 teaspoons table salt | Salt · table - 1.5 tsp | 
| 3 sticks (340 grams) unsalted butter, very cold | Butter · without salt - 3 stick | 
| 3/4 cup very cold water | Water · bottled · generic - 0.75 cup | 
| Filling | |
| 1 pound yukon gold potatoes, peeled if desired, cut into 1/2-inch slices | Potatoes · red · flesh and skin · raw - 450 g | 
| 10 ounces spinach (baby, “grown-up,” or frozen) | Spinach · raw - 1 package (10 oz) | 
| 1 cup coarsely grated sharp cheddar cheese | Cheese · cheddar - 1 cup, shredded | 
| 4 scallions, thinly sliced | Onions · spring or scallions (includes tops and bulb) · raw - 4 medium (4-1/8" long) | 
| 11 large eggs + 1 large egg white | Egg · whole · raw · fresh - 11.5 large | 
| 1 teaspoon kosher or coarse sea salt, plus more to taste | Salt · table - 1 tsp | 
| Freshly ground black pepper | Spices · pepper · black - 1 tsp, ground | 
| To finish | |
| 1 large egg yolk (leftover from filling) | Egg · yolk · raw · fresh - 1 large | 
| 1 teaspoon water | Water · bottled · generic - 1 tsp |

Advanced mode
- RDA (Recommended Dietary Allowances) - the daily daietary intake level of a nutrient that meet the requirements of 97.5% of healthy individuals in particular age group and gender.
- AI (Adequate Intake) - recommended average daily nutrient intake assumed to be adequate based on approximation of observed mean nutrient intake by a group of healthy people, used when an RDA cannot be determined.
- UL (Tolerable upper intake levels) - the highest level of daily consumption that current data have shown to cause no side effects in humans when used indefinitely without medical supervision.
